From 86091f94b6ca58f4b8795503b274492d6a935c15 Mon Sep 17 00:00:00 2001 From: Alexandru Gagniuc Date: Wed, 30 Sep 2015 20:23:09 -0700 Subject: cpu/mtrr.h: Fix macro names for MTRR registers We use UNDERSCORE_CASE. For the MTRR macros that refer to an MSR, we also remove the _MSR suffix, as they are, by definition, MSRs.
